    Sony Vaio battery problems.


    Hey guys, im not sure if this is the right section or not but oh well.

    I have a sony vaio VGN-NR31J/s laptop, and i recently installed Windows 7 ultimate, it runs perfectally but im having some issues with my battery.

    First problem is that i only get about 30-40 minutes maximum battery life, opposed to the 3 - 3.5 hours i had on vista.

    The other problem is that it takes a whopping 5 hours to charge back up!

    i have no idea whats causing these problems, i have installed the most up to date drivers for everything, installed sony vaio power management and tweaked every setting possible, but still no change.

    With Lithium ion batteries, you will want to turn off sleep and hibernate and drain them once per month.

    Completely drain the battery, then fully charge it.

    It will help, but it may be beyond repair if you have never done this.

    It can't hurt to try it.

    You can also go in to advanced power options and change the settings on the battery.
